Home Foundation Repair in Rockingham County, NH
Home foundation repair services address issues related to the structural stability of a property’s foundation. Projects typically include fixing cracks, settling, or shifting in basement or crawl space walls, piers, and footings. These repairs help prevent further damage to the building’s structure, improve safety, and protect against issues such as water intrusion or uneven flooring. Property owners often want to understand the signs of foundation problems, the types of repair methods available, and how repairs can stabilize and preserve the value of their home.
Before requesting foundation repair services, homeowners should assess the extent of the damage and consider any visible signs such as c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, or uneven floors. It’s also helpful to understand the underlying causes, such as soil movement or moisture issues, which can influence the appropriate repair approach. Clear communication about the specific concerns and a thorough inspection can aid in determining the most effective solution for maintaining the long-term stability of the property.

Common Home Foundation Repair Jobs
Basement Foundation Repair - stabilizes and restores basement walls affected by shifting or cracking.
Slab Foundation Repair - addresses uneven or cracked concrete slabs to prevent further damage.
Pier and Beam Repair - reinforces or replaces supports to ensure a stable and level foundation.
Crack Repair - seals and fills foundation cracks to prevent water intrusion and structural issues.
Waterproofing Services - prevents water from seeping into foundations, reducing the risk of damage.
Settlement Repair - corrects uneven settling to maintain the integrity of the home’s structure.
Home Foundation Repair Questions
What signs indicate foundation issues? C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ors that stick may suggest foundation problems.
What causes foundation settlement? Soil movement, moisture changes, and poor drainage can lead to foundation settling over time.
Are foundation repairs necessary for minor cracks? Small cracks that are stable typically do not require repair, but ongoing movement should be assessed by a professional.
What types of foundation repair services are available? Common options include underpinning, piering, and stabilization to address various foundation concerns.
